PITTSBURG, CA—Atlanta-based multifamily brokerage firm ARA, has completed the sale of Los Prados, a 242-unit apartment complex located in Pittsburg. The property, built in 1985, is conveniently located near the Pittsburg/Bay Point BART station and Highway 4, which leads to regional employment centers throughout the Bay Area. Waterton Associates sold the property to McDowell Properties for $32,500,000, $134,298 per unit and $157 per square foot.

Rents at recently renovated properties in the immediate competitive set have consistently achieved measurable premiums over non-renovated units at Los Prados, lending strong support for the implementation of renovations by the new owner. The much higher rents being achieved in Walnut Creek and Concord, further support this strategy, ARA says.  Los Prados was 93% occupied at the time of sale.

“We are very pleased to complete the sale of Los Prados.  The asset was acquired in an older investment vehicle now in disposition mode and after a longer than anticipated hold period, we are very happy with the execution and outcome of the investment,” said Field Stern of Waterton Associates. Jake Gentling of McDowell Properties commented, “We are excited to expand our presence in the Bay Area with the purchase of Los Prados.  This acquisition is consistent with our strategy to acquire and reposition assets in dynamic locations across the country.  We plan on spending additional capital to improve the property's curb appeal while taking advantage of the positive, long-term apartment trends in the East Bay.”

The ARA Pacific team, led by San Francisco-based principal, Mark Leary, served as the exclusive advisors on the transaction. According to ARA's Leary, “One of the most compelling attributes of Los Prados is the evidence of an immediate renovation upside. Given the asset's quality of construction and favorable unit attributes, there is a value-add potential through cosmetic upgrades to the unit interiors in addition to enhancement of the community amenities.”

McDowell Properties focuses on the acquisition, management and repositioning of multifamily properties in growth markets throughout the United States. Founded in 1995, Waterton Associates LLC is a real estate investor and operator with a focus on U.S. multifamily properties. ARA focuses exclusively on the brokerage, financing and capital sourcing of multihousing properties.
